Where
In Anniston, 60 miles east of Birmingham. Mailing address: Commander, Fort McClellan, AL
36205
Major units
U.S. Army Military Police School; U.S. Army Chemical School
Population
2,164 active duty; 2,291 family members; 200 Guard; 550 Reserve; 1,688 civilians
Changes ahead
Scheduled to close by Sept. 30, 1999. Army Chemical School and Army Military Police School
to move to Fort Leonard Wood, Mo.
